High-Performance Glazing for High-Performance Windows

Curb appeal and lasting quality are among the top considerations of every homeowner when it comes to their home. In an effort to incorporate both beauty and caliber, more and more homeowners are choosing to install windows with large glass areas, such as timeless picture windows and the like.

In this post, Renewal by Andersen® of Montana explains the best glazing options for windows with large glass areas.

High Performance™  Low-E4® Glass

It’s difficult to fully enjoy the view afforded to you by your windows if the glazing performs poorly, causing your energy bills to soar. Renewal by Andersen addresses cooling and heating concerns by offering the High Performance™  Low-E4® glass option. This type of glazing is up to 56% more energy-efficient in the summer, and up to 47% more energy-efficient during the colder months compared to clear, ordinary dual pane glass.

High-Performance™ Low-E4® SmartSun™

If you want all the benefits of high visibility but none of the damage caused by ultraviolet rays, then the High-Performance™ Low-E4® SmartSun™ glass is for you. This glazing is Renewal by Andersen’s most energy-efficient option yet. Its energy efficiency fares up to 70% better in the summer and up to 49% better in the winter compared to traditional dual-pane glass. It also has excellent noise-reduction capabilities in addition to its exceptional thermal control capacities. Consider using High-Performance™ Low-E4® SmartSun™ glass for your next window replacement project.

High Performance™ Low-E4® SmartSun™ Glass With HeatLock® Technology™

The newest technology allows this glazing to retain heat within the room while the SmartSun™ lends low-emissivity properties to the glass. This type of glass is perfect for homes in cold climates. It delivers triple-pane performance in a dual-pane configuration.

High Performance™ Low-E4® Sun Glass

Say goodbye to ridiculously high cooling costs with High Performance™ Low-E4® Sun glass. It filters out solar heat gain and damage, keeping your home cool and comfortable even in hot weather. Enjoy subtle tints that reduce visible light by installing this type of glazing. It goes well with just about any window style, from sliding windows to double-hung.
